Despite your most diligent efforts in maintenance and repairs, the HVAC system in your Ballston Lake, NY home has a finite lifespan. Knowing when to replace your HVAC equipment rather than fix it could help you save. Fortunately, there are several signs that make it easy to determine your HVAC system’s needs.

The Age of Your Heating and Cooling Equipment

Some recent heater models have maximum life expectancies of up to 30 years. However, many heaters and air conditioners provide far less than three decades of reliable service. Most have lost half or more of their efficiency after just 10 years of service, and a number of these units fail within 15 to 20 years of installation. If your heater or air conditioner is 10 years old or older, you can expect an increasingly frequent need for repairs as time goes by. Worse still, the efficiency losses of aging HVAC equipment are often progressive until it’s replaced.

Your Cumulative Repair Costs

Take a minute to total up your HVAC repair bills for the last two to three years. You may be surprised to find that you’ve paid close to the amount of a heater or AC replacement. If your cumulative repair costs are already high and still mounting, it’s probably time to swap your equipment out.

Ongoing Increases in Your Home Energy Bills

Compare your current month’s energy bill with an energy bill from this time last year. If your charges are significantly higher but your household dynamics or HVAC use haven’t changed, getting new heating and cooling equipment is likely the most cost-effective choice.

A Substantial Decline in Your Indoor Air Quality

Aging central HVAC systems struggle to create uniform temperatures throughout homes. They also have an increasingly harder time regulating humidity and filtering the indoor air. Thus, in addition to hot and cold spots, you might have heavy, oppressive air, mold problems, and a noticeable decline in your indoor air quality (IAQ). Although tune-up service and essential repairs might help with your HVAC system’s performance, they’ll do little to alleviate the IAQ-related sniffling, sneezing, and coughing of building residents.
